Property Location
Located in St. George (Downtown St. George), Claridge Inn is within a 5-minute drive of Fiesta Family Fun Center and Rosenbruch Wildlife Museum. This motel is 15.1 mi (24.4 km) from Sand Hollow State Park and 1.1 mi (1.7 km) from Dixie Convention Center.

Rooms
Make yourself at home in one of the 50 air-conditioned rooms featuring flat-screen televisions.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and cable programming is available for your entertainment. Bathrooms have shower/tub combinations and hair dryers. Conveniences include irons/ironing boards and blackout drapes/curtains, and housekeeping is provided daily.

Amenities
Don't miss out on recreational opportunities including an outdoor pool and a hot tub. Additional amenities at this motel include complimentary wireless internet access and a vending machine.

Business, Other Amenities
Featured amenities include a 24-hour front desk and a vending machine. Free self parking is available onsite.

Don’t be fooled- this is a 1.5 at best! Maybe my expectations are too high, but at the very least your room should be clean and the area should have some sort of security on the premises to patrol that guests are staying in line... We stayed here on a Friday night- we figured since we were just basically sleeping here after a show in downtown St. George, that $120 was about all we wanted to pay- our usual places were sold out- in retrospect I wouldn’t pay over $50 for this place- the room was basic, which wasn’t the problem, it was just not clean - the floor looked like it hadn’t been vacuumed- there was debris up against the bed- the carpet was stained by some kind of bleach, the bedsore was stained, the bathroom lights were exposed without a cover by and made a terrible noise, the sink stopper was broken ... then with the room being on the upper floor, it was over the pool area- so at 10:40 pm- people were still swimming and yelling- ridiculous! If we wouldn’t have prepaid, we would have just left! We probably should have anyway . The only redeeming factor was that it was close to several places to grab a bite to eat- Denny’s, Black Bear Diner, and McDonalds.. We love St George, and we have stayed at other places, but we will be much more careful when picking accommodations next time!
